Lagos Muslim Pilgrims Board Boss Seeks Commitment Of Staff

Posted on January 14, 2022

The newly appointed Executive Secretary, Lagos State Muslim Pilgrims Welfare Board (LSMWPB), Imam AbdulHakeem Kosoko, has appealed to members of staff of the Board to show absolute commitment and dedication to their official duties.

He spoke on Wednesday during the send-forth ceremony organised by the Board in honour of the immediate past Executive Secretary, Mr. Rahman Ishola, who was recently posted to another establishment in the State Public Service.

While promising to ensure equity and justice during his administration, Kosoko hinted that there would be a review of the mode of operations of the Board for improved service delivery.

Imam Kosoko praised the former Board Secretary, Mr. Ishola, for his various achievements at the Board and described him as a very wonderful colleague, brother and friend of many years.

In his response, Mr. Ishola expressed his appreciation to the Almighty Allah for His love and mercy throughout his tenure at the Board.

While acknowledging the fact that he has been friends with Imam Kosoko for many years, Ishola expressed gratitude to Allah for the privilege of being the first Civil Servant to be given a political appointment as an Executive Secretary of the Board since it was established in 1976.

Ishola, therefore, urged the staff to extend all necessary cooperation to his successor, assuring the new Board Secretary that the staff would render support to ensure he excels in the new assignment.
